Ex-SCEE Senior Producer on PS4: “Feels Like Sony Are Back on Form”

Phil Gaskell believes gamers are in for a treat.

In conversation with PSU, former Sony Computer Entertainment Europe senior producer Phil Gaskell – who’s worked on Super Stardust HD and Dead Nation – believes that with the PS4, Sony are back on form. Gaskell left SCEE and founded Ripstone Games in 2011.

“When we were still at Sony we were lucky enough to work with PS4 in its infancy, so it’s fantastic to see it fully realised and it’s a clear triumph for Mark Cerny – the lead architect – and the team.

“It feels like Sony are back on form, and as someone who started his career at Sony it makes the hairs on the back of my neck stand up. The exciting aspects for me are how connected these new consoles are, they’ve been built with today’s digital and connected world in mind. I think all us gamers are in for a treat.”

The PlayStation 4 is due to launch on November 15th in North America and November 29th in Europe.
